What Are Aqua Shoes?
-
Traction
-
Aqua shoes are generally designed to provide traction for the user. This can be particularly important in water, where surfaces may be slippery. The soles of aqua shoes should be sufficiently textured to grab wet, slippery surfaces.
Comfort
-
Quality aqua shoes usually have a stretchy upper portion that will support the foot without constricting it. If the aqua shoes are made from lightweight materials they will tend to dry quickly, allowing for more comfort if the shoes are worn for a long period of time.
Sturdy Soles
-
Aqua shoes are useful for walking on rocky beaches, streams or river beds. Aqua shoes are also helpful for protecting feet from the rough surfaces of pool bottoms. With extended exposure to these surfaces, bare feet can become raw, sore and irritated. Aqua shoes with sturdy soles will protect the bottoms of feet from soreness and injury.
Warmth
-
Another advantage of aqua shoes is the extra layer of warmth that the upper fabric can provide wet feet. This may be especially true in situations where it is breezy and feet may even cramp from the cold.
Price
-
Aqua shoes are available at sporting goods stores, fitness stores and many online websites. They generally range in price from $25 for basic shoes to $75 for name-brand shoes with special designs and features.
